What "fast" really means in first aid training
When individuals look for fast first aid, fast cpr, or fast certification, they typically suggest one of 3 things:
Short overall course time, preferably within a single day. Minimal time far from work or family. The quickest course to a legitimate first aid certificate.Those are all sensible wishes. Many adults do not have the luxury of multi day first aid and cpr training classes. The industry has actually responded with fast first aid training layouts: express first aid courses that press the face to face part, fast cpr correspondence course options, and blended models where you do concept online and a useful session in person.
The vital difference is not fast versus sluggish. It is fast with proper hands on method, versus fast with video just. Both can call themselves a first aid course. Just one genuinely prepares you to respond when a person is grey, not breathing properly, and your own adrenaline is spiking.
When I speak about fast first aid courses that still work, I suggest training that reduces the class time without removing out the tactile skills: breast compressions, rollovers right into the healing placement, inhaler assist, EpiPen practice, and basic injury administration. That is really different from a totally on the internet just first aid course where the only point you press is the "Next" button.
What online just first aid and CPR courses in fact teach
Online just first aid training and cpr courses vary a whole lot in quality, yet they share common traits.
They show acknowledgment and theory well. You can discover symptoms and signs of a stroke, how to recognize an asthma flare, or the actions of cardiopulmonary resuscitation: look for danger, check response, open the airway, check breathing, start compressions.
Where they battle is translation right into performance under pressure.
If all you desire is an introduction to first aid and cpr, or a refresher on the sequence of activities after you have already been educated, an on-line program can be valuable. It is especially convenient for:
- Revising guidelines after adjustments, such as compression rate or fundamental life support sequences. Learning background details for fap first aid in work environments where an in person refresher is already scheduled. Giving family members a common language prior to you participate in a practical course together.
However, when organisations count only on online first aid and cpr course material to license personnel, you see the voids immediately. In a drill, individuals remember that they need to "tilt the head back" yet think twice to touch the client. They know they have to "push set" on the upper body, but their compressions are either so superficial they hardly move the sternum or two wild that their arms fatigue in thirty seconds.
You can not feel appropriate compression depth through a display. You can not experience the resistance of a youngster sized manikin unless you really kneel next to it, adjust your hand placement, and get mentoring in actual time.
Online just first aid courses likewise can not evaluate your capability to manage a scene with spectators, phones calling, and ecological dangers. They can present a tidy scenario with several selection actions. Reality seldom looks like that.
Fast, express, and mixed: where they excel
Fast first aid courses and express first aid training have a bad online reputation in some circles, as if "fast" immediately means "dodgy". That is not always fair.
Well developed express first aid courses make use of a combined format: online concept finished before the course date, combined with a lean, highly concentrated in person session. Rather than investing class time reviewing slides regarding shock or burns, the group shows up keeping that background already covered. The instructor can after that allocate most of the in person time to situations, practice, debrief, and assessment.
The best fast first aid training programs that I have actually delivered or audited share a few attributes:
They established clear pre course work assumptions. Individuals recognize they have to finish an online component or workbook beforehand, usually taking 2 to 4 hours. It covers meanings, legal duties, infection control, and standard anatomy.
The in person session is compact however intense. For a typical first aid and cpr course, this might be a four to five hour block, in some cases much shorter for a fast cpr correspondence course. You move in between manikins, partner job, bandaging, role play, and Q&A. There is really little sitting still.
The ratio of instructor to individuals remains reasonable. When you get beyond concerning 12 participants per instructor, the top quality of comments on CPR technique, risk-free lifting, and respiratory tract management goes down swiftly, particularly in an express first aid course.
Assessment concentrates on skills, not just recall. You are observed replying to scenarios: a subconscious breathing casualty, a non breathing casualty requiring CPR, a bleeding wound, an anaphylaxis situation with an auto injector.
This design works especially well for people who already have some direct exposure to first aid. For instance, a health and fitness trainer doing an express cpr course each year, or a child care educator renewing express childcare first aid, picks up where they ended and develops their technique.
The risk shows up when suppliers cut edges: no pre work, minimal guidance, five people on one manikin, and an instructor that rushes through each subject because they have to finish the express first aid training in 2 hours. That is not fast training. That is box ticking.
Why hands on still matters, despite perfect theory
I have actually had individuals recite the whole DRSABCD or chain of survival series from memory, then freeze the moment I ask to demonstrate it on a manikin. The void in between recognizing and doing is where hands on first aid courses make their keep.
There are specific minutes that almost no one solves the first time without responses:
Opening the airway in a subconscious adult without over expanding the neck.
Finding the proper hand placement for compressions on an infant.
Compressing to the appropriate deepness and price on a grown-up manikin without "jumping" or leaning on the chest.
Rolling a larger casualty right into the healing setting as a smaller sized rescuer without twisting the spine.
Coordinating breaths with compressions in a first aid and cpr course, particularly when you fear or breathless yourself.
These are skills you really feel as much as you see. A trainer can position their hands lightly over yours, change the stress, and claim, "Feel that resistance? That has to do with right." No online only cpr training can duplicate that physical guidance.
Another ignored element is mental readiness. During real-time first aid training, even in a fast first aid course, you practise speaking up loud:
"I am checking for threat."
"You, call an ambulance."
"I am starting compressions now."
The first time somebody hears their very own voice give strong guidelines in a simulated emergency situation, you see their shoulders straighten. They stop looking for approval and start acting. That shift is virtually impossible to accomplish with a solo online module.
Compliance, market needs, and what "matters"
For people, the question is typically "What will in fact make me qualified?" For organisations, it swiftly comes to be "What does the legislation or our regulator call for from first aid and cpr training classes?"

Requirements differ by territory and field, however a couple of patterns are consistent.
Many workplace safety regulatory authorities expect first aid training to consist of a practical element. A totally online just first aid course may not please your work environment's obligations, even if it provides a first aid certificate. Insurance companies and auditors progressively check not just whether certificates exist, but whether the training met acknowledged standards.
In childcare and very early youth education and learning, the bar is higher again. Express childcare first aid courses are normally approved only when they are delivered by accredited providers and consist of hands on demonstration of abilities: baby and child CPR, monitoring of bronchial asthma and anaphylaxis, and emergency reactions for common childhood years injuries. Express child care first aid training that is on-line only seldom satisfies these standards.
If your duty includes marine guidance, sports mentoring, or safety and security, you might discover that a fast cpr course serves for refresher training, however only if your preliminary qualification was acquired face to face. Reading the fine print matters. A fast first aid course near me that markets "totally on-line and immediate" might satisfy no regulator at all, also if it does issue a pdf certificate.
When unsure, inspect three things: your regional office health and safety authority, your market regulatory authority or organization, and your organisation's insurance policy carrier. They usually define whether blended and express first aid courses are acceptable, and whether online only training can ever stand alone.

Special instance: childcare and paediatric first aid
Parents and child care instructors usually ask if express child care first aid is "adequate". Below the sort of case changes, therefore does the emotional load.
Most extreme paediatric emergency situations include choking, breathing problems, allergies, seizures, or head injuries. The techniques are much more delicate than grown-up first aid. Chest compressions on an infant, for instance, make use of 2 fingers or more thumbs, with dramatically much less depth. The Fast CPR training margin for error is smaller.

During express childcare first aid courses, I pay specific focus to:
Hand placement and deepness for baby and child CPR.
Clearing an obstructed airway in a conscious youngster without striking too hard.

Safe use EpiPens and bronchial asthma inhalers in scared or struggling children.
Managing multiple children while one is weak, especially in solo instructor scenarios.
Communicating with parents and emergency situation solutions clearly and calmly.
You can explain these ideas in an on the internet module, but you can not mimic the feeling of positioning 2 fingers on a manikin's little sternum and seeing the breast press the right amount. Nor can you practice de escalating stressed moms and dads via a test screen.
For that reason, I take into consideration child care a non negotiable area for combined or face to face express child care first aid training. Online only should be booked for interim refresher courses or sustaining understanding, not as the sole training method.
How to pick the ideal course style for you or your team
There is no solitary ideal format for every single person or organisation. The much better concern is: what mix of speed, convenience, and depth gives you real world ability, not just a certificate?
Here a brief list assists cut through advertising language and concentrate your decision.
Quick list for assessing fast first aid and CPR options
- Check if the course consists of a real-time useful component, either in person or actual time digital, with evaluation of your skills. Confirm that the provider and certain first aid course or cpr course satisfy the needs of your office regulatory authority or sector body. Ask about trainer to pupil ratio, number of manikins, and how much time is designated to hands on CPR, recovery position, and situation practice. Look for combined or express first aid courses that call for meaningful pre work, not just a 10 min quiz, so the in person time can concentrate on practice. Be wary of any fast first aid course that guarantees full certification in under an hour without real-time trainer interaction at all.
If a service provider can not address these questions clearly, or ends up being unclear when you request information, treat that as an indication. A first aid certificate is only as useful as the abilities behind it.
